And of course you need to read <a href=\"https:\/\/www.escapistbookblog.com\/?p=22252\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">Violent Things<\/a> to understand this second story arc for them.<\/p>\n<blockquote><p><i>I am the devil standing on her shoulder \u2026 I am her dark prince, leading her down paths she would never walk alone.<\/i><\/p><\/blockquote>\n<p>Zeth and Sloane are happy, committed, and as loved up and filthy as ever. Again, I loved seeing them together, and I love how functional and open they are with each other. Zeth Mayfair is a badass, plain and simple. He\u2019s a violent and dangerous killer, but he protects those that are close to him, and his love for his family, and for the woman he claimed as his, is clear in all that he does. And there\u2019s just something amazing about seeing such a darkly dangerous man so deeply in love.<\/p>\n<p>I thought there was a limit to how much one person could care about another, but it turns out I was wrong. It turns out the depths that you can love someone are boundless. I don\u2019t think I\u2019ll ever reach a point where I can truly say I\u2019ve reached my capacity for caring for this woman. It makes me weak. Vulnerable. It feels dangerous most of the time, but there\u2019s nothing I can do about it. I\u2019m fucking addicted to her, and I wouldn\u2019t change that for the world.<\/p>\n<p>Zeth and Sloane have been through hell, and are happily settling into some sort of peace together, but life has other ideas. Not only is as an organised crime threat from the East Coast moving in on Seattle with Zeth firmly in their sights, but DEA Agent Lowell is also in town and gunning to take down Zeth once and for all \u2013 no matter who gets caught in the crossfire.<\/p>\n<p>The danger is building, and coming <i>very<\/i> close to home, and Zeth is gearing up once again to fight back and protect the ones he loves.<\/p>\n<blockquote><p><i>\u201cThose motherfuckers will wish they\u2019d never heard the name Zeth Mayfair. I swear, they\u2019ll wish they\u2019d never been born.\u201d <\/i><\/p><\/blockquote>\n<p>The secondary storyline featuring young mechanic and part-time fighter, Mason, is woven into the book with equal importance, and I\u2019m still gobsmacked over his storyline. Mason completely won me over with his love for his ill younger sister and his determination to do whatever he had to in order to protect and provide for her. I fell for his compassionate heart, and this book finds him stuck in an impossible situation as he fights for his sister, and for his very life as outside influences threaten everything. Mason\u2019s life collides into Zeth and Sloane\u2019s with even more intensity in this book, and I can\u2019t wait to see how that is all going to unfold.<\/p>\n<p>Raw, emotional, dark, gritty and heartbreaking, Callie Hart brings all the feels in this book (and yeah, it made me cry). There are some huge game changers, and life will never be the same for any of these beloved characters.
